I have a Team Losi Pro SE 2wd buggy for sale. Thats right, PRO SE . Its got Lunsford Ti turnbuckles, airtronics 94737 servo, Novak 410-M1C speed control, ball bearing steering kit, also has the Losi 3 gear transmission upgrade, slipper clutch with Hydra-drive. I have an extra pair of new front wheels w/o tires, spare front and rear arms, hub carriers, misc spare parts. Can be made a RTR, I have an old Airtronics CS2P radio and a Airtronics 27 band FM receiver included also. Has an old Maxtec stock motor in it. This car was awesome back in the day! Make a great play car, or throw it on the track in stock and see how good of a driver you really are!
